Output 89bf3aef92730728fa59b6307d44f395a9663f0eb956659aa1ced38c019d9c86:0

value
544130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e28e9fc6a7653d11d600d66595fb05e1b2da355 OP_EQUAL
address
MKQEPMbZzvZx7SnaGXRQn2gVJubtHCAurQ
transaction
89bf3aef92730728fa59b6307d44f395a9663f0eb956659aa1ced38c019d9c86
spent
true